photo area Christopher Poulsen
Associate Professor of Geological Sciences and Atmospheric, Oceanic, and Space Sciences


Ph.D. Pennsylvania State University, 1999



Fields of Study
Professor Poulsen’s research interests are in Earth System History, paleoclimatology, and paleoceanography. His research focuses on the interactions within the climate system, including those among the oceans, atmosphere, cryosphere, and biosphere, in an effort to understand the processes that shape past and future global climate change.
